Peltier module (thermoelectric module) is a thermal control module that has both "warming" and "cooling" effects. By passing an electric current through the module, it is possible to change the surface temperature and keep it at the target temperature. The TEC1 12715 model signifies a high-performance Peltier module:
- "TEC" stands for Thermoelectric Cooler.
- "1" indicates it's a single-stage module.
- "127" refers to the number of P-N semiconductor couples (junctions) within the module, which are responsible for the heat transfer.
- "15" denotes its maximum current rating, typically 15 Amperes.
This module is designed to operate optimally around 12V DC (with a maximum voltage typically around 15.4V) and can achieve a significant temperature differential (ΔTmax) of up to 70°C between its hot and cold surfaces (under ideal conditions with no heat load on the cold side and efficient heat dissipation from the hot side). It's crucial to note that the hot side must be effectively cooled with a proper heatsink and fan to prevent thermal runaway and ensure efficient cooling on the cold side. Without adequate heat dissipation, the module will quickly reach thermal equilibrium and cease to cool.
With dimensions typically around 40mm x 40mm x 3.6mm, the TEC1 12715 is compact, solid-state (no moving parts), vibration-free, and virtually silent. Its robust design and high cooling capacity (Qmax typically ranging from 92W to 225W depending on conditions and specific manufacturer's rating) make it a popular choice for various thermal management challenges for enthusiasts and professionals in Pune, Maharashtra, India, and globally.

How to Use:
-
Attach the cold side to the item you want to cool (e.g., CPU, aluminum plate).
-
Mount a heatsink and fan on the hot side for effective heat dissipation.
-
Connect to a 12V DC power supply (capable of 5–6A).
-
Monitor temperature using a thermistor or digital sensor (e.g., DHT11, DS18B20).
-
For automated control, use with a MOSFET or relay switch and Arduino or thermostat controller.
